    @@JaimeMesChiens And the jobs that they generally pick are always the same...engineer, surgeon, working on an oil rig or being in the military. A huge flag is none of these positions would require money to get out or leave wherever they are at. Someone in the military wouldn't need money to come home, for food or to pay for a new weapon because they lost theirs (I've heard that ridiculous story before on other accounts of being scammed). These employers wouldn't leave anyone behind, all travel and accommodation is paid for, especially on oil rigs and any U.S. military, they don't have to pay for anything.     “ he knows how to cut me off and come back in - cut me off and come back in…” THIS statement explains A LOT! We can infer that she has a FEAR of losing connection with him, and she is describing that he was skilled at *exploiting* that fear to keep her “on the hook”. Just like IRL ABUSERS, romance scammers SEEK out those who demonstrate they will prioritize sustaining their “connection” to the abuser even if it’s at the expense of aspects of their own well being. It’s the playbook they both use to get their victims to accept more and more outlandish things in order to “keep him” in her life.

    Anyone that contacts you out the blue and says they work on an oil rig should be the first red flag - it’s a favourite scenario of scammers. This front allows them to have lots of excuses why they can’t FaceTime or need money transfers as they’re isolated.
